Wet cat food gives your kitty a burst of moisture in every bite. While dry food is crunchy and helps with dental health, wet food is softer and packs extra water that helps your cat’s urinary health and kidneys. Its tender texture and rich smell make it a favorite, even for the pickiest eaters.

If you want to boost your cat’s water intake, try mixing a bit of water into the wet food to create a light soup or serve it in a shallow bowl to encourage slurping. Keeping meal sizes consistent and refilling the water bowl often can add even more hydration benefits. | Vitamin A | Helps with clear vision and keeps skin healthy |
| Vitamin D | Helps bones grow strong by assisting calcium absorption |
| Vitamin E | Protects cells with antioxidant power |
| Zinc | Supports a strong immune system and skin repair |

When it's time to switch your cat’s food, start by adding a small spoonful of the new food into the usual mix. Keep an eye on your kitty as their tummy gets used to it. This gradual change helps ensure a smooth transition and a happy, comfortable pet.

Feeding Guidelines and Portion Control with Hill’s Pet Nutrition Cat Food
When feeding your cat, getting the portion just right makes all the difference. Hill’s feeding charts offer a simple guide to serving the correct amount based on your cat’s age, weight, and activity level. These charts help maintain a balanced calorie intake, support easy digestion, and ensure your cat gets the essential nutrients needed at every stage of life. It’s all about keeping your pet energetic and healthy.
Here's a quick rundown:
- Each day, measure out your cat’s food using the amounts suggested by Hill’s chart.
- As your cat grows or its activity level shifts, adjust the portions accordingly.
- Divide the total daily food into several smaller meals.
- Regularly check your cat’s weight to see if the portions are working well.
- Use a standard measuring cup to keep every meal consistent.
Sometimes your cat’s needs might change, requiring a gradual tweak in feeding amounts for weight loss or gain. A small change each week, while keeping a close eye on your pet’s health, can help settle them into a steady routine that supports a happy, balanced life.

Where is Hill’s Pet Nutrition headquarters located?
Hill’s Pet Nutrition headquarters is in Topeka, Kansas. This hub drives their research, product development, and quality control to ensure trusted pet food formulas.

What meat should you never feed your cat?
It’s best to avoid raw or undercooked meats, especially pork, as they can carry harmful bacteria and parasites that may jeopardize your cat’s health.
